Abstract

A 450 Mev synchrotron radiation source INDUS-1 is being constructed at the Centre for Advanced Technology, Indore, as a national facility for performing various types of experimental work in the vacuum ultra violet to soft X-ray region of the spectrum. In this facility a high resolution VUV beamline will be set up for various types of atomic and molecular physics experiments/This beamline uses a combination of three cylindrical mirrors which focuses the light originating from the tangent point of the storage ring onto the horizontal entrance slit of a spectrometer. The spectrometer uses a 66.65 meter concave grating having a groove density of 4800 g/mm which is mounted in the off-plane eagle mounting. It will cover the spectral region of 400 A - 2000 A with an average spectral resolution of 0.005 A. In this paper we have discussed the intensity and the imaging properties of the beamline.
